What is Google Cloud Photo?

Google Cloud Photo is like that friend who always has your back — it holds onto your photos and videos while letting you access them anytime and anywhere! You can upload your photos directly from your phone or computer, and voilà! You have a digital gallery that’s as organized as your closet (after a Pinterest binge).

The Pros: Why You’ll Fall Head over Heels

  1. Unlimited Storage (with a catch): Google Cloud Photo offers unlimited storage for photos up to 16 megapixels and videos up to 1080p. But let’s be real, if you think your phone will ever store anything bigger than your life ambitions, think again.

  2. Automatic Backup: You can set your phone to automatically upload your pictures, so you can snap away while living your best life without worrying about your storage space. Goodbye, "Storage Full" notifications — hello, carefree selfies!

  3. Search Like a Pro: Forget scrolling endlessly through thousands of pictures. Google’s smart technology allows you to search for photos based on the content. Want to find that pic of you and your bestie at the beach? Just type "beach" and boom — there it is!

  4. Sharing Made Simple: With a few taps, you can share your favorite memories with friends and family, or even your secret crush (who doesn’t love a cute dog pic?). Plus, you can create shared albums, so everyone can contribute their snaps from that wild night out.

Alternatives Worth Considering

While Google Cloud Photo is fabulous, it’s not the only fish in the sea! Let’s peek at a few alternatives:

  • Apple iCloud: If you’re already in the Apple ecosystem, this is a no-brainer. It’s seamless and integrates perfectly with your Apple devices.
  • Dropbox: More than just a storage service, Dropbox allows you to share files and collaborate easily. Just don’t forget where you put your ex’s mixtape!
  • Amazon Photos: If you’re a Prime member, why not take advantage? Unlimited photo storage is included, and it’s a great way to keep your memories safe and sound.
